Ibrahim Traoré (born 14 March 1988) be a Burkinabé military officer den politician wey serve as de interim Presido of Burkina Faso since 2022.
Na Traoré take control of Burkina Faso insyd September 2022, ousting interim president Paul-Henri Sandaogo Damiba insyd a coup d'état.[1] For age 37, he be currently de second-youngest head of state insyd de world.[2] During ein tenure, na Traoré seek make he distance de country from ein former colonial power, France, wey he play an instrumental role insyd founding de Alliance of Sahel States.
Early life
Na dem born Ibrahim Traoré insyd Kéra, Bondokuy, Mouhoun Province, for 14 March 1988.[3][4] After he receive ein primary education insyd Bondokuy, he attend a high school insyd Bobo-Dioulasso wer na he be known as he be "quiet" den "very talented".[5] From 2006, na he study geology for de University of Ouagadougou. Na he be part of de Association of Muslim Students[6] den de Marxist Association nationale des étudiants du Burkina (ANEB). For de latter insyd, na he rise make he delegate wey he cam be known for he dey defend ein classmates for disputes insyd. Na he graduate from de university plus honors.
